Vibration Analysis of Rotary Type Rice Transplanter (Part 2)
Experimental Analysis on Vibration of Planting Mechanism

Abstract

Experimental analysis was conducted to understand the fundamental vibration of planting parts. The speed of driving shaft was changed, and the characteristics of variation were investigated with respect to the acceleration, the torque of driving shaft and the supporting load of planting parts. The maximum amplitude of acceleration were-40 to 34 [m/s2] in both vertical and horizontal directions, which appeared when the planting fingers acted. The torque of drive shaft, which had no connection with the speed of revolution, were in the range of 6.0 to 7.7 [N·m]. The change of supporting loads showed a similar tendency with that of acceleration. Composing the load in both directions, it was found that large forces acted at the operating time of planting fingers nearly in the vertical direction.
